Andrey Kashechkin has been sacked by his Astana team following confirmation of a positive test for blood doping. His team leader, Kazakh compatriot Alexandre Vinokourov, was sacked during the Tour de France for the same reason.
"As it was to be expected, the B sample of Andrej Kashechkin has also tested positive for blood doping," said Astana in a statement.
"After being temporarily suspended by the Astana cycling team, Kashechkin is dismissed with immediate effect."
Kashechkin, who finished third overall in last year's Tour of Spain, was snared during a random doping control while training in Turkey on 1 August.
Both he and Vinokourov have protested their innocence and vowed to fight their sanctions. Both are facing two-year bans from the sport.
Astana withdrew from the Tour de France following Vinokourov's positive test and were subsequently banned from the Tour of Spain, which begins on 1 September.
